A well-developed mortgage market

The mortgage market in the Netherlands is very well developed. There is a large choice of mortgage providers, so you need to know a bit about how each type of mortgage works, in order to decide between them.

Be aware that as an expat buyer, you might not have access to such a broad range of mortgage providers in the Netherlands.
